市场波动中的交易策略与风险管理
市场价格的波动往往受到多种因素的影响,包括经济环境、资金流向和市场情绪等。对于交易者而言,如何在波动中制定有效的策略,并合理控制风险,是长期稳定盈利的关键。
一、市场波动的核心因素
1. 供需变化
市场的价格走势主要由供需关系决定。当需求上升而供应不足时,价格可能上涨;反之,若供应增加但需求下降,价格可能承压。
2. 资金流向
资金的进出对市场价格具有直接影响。大资金流入可能推动价格上涨,而资金流出的市场往往面临回调压力。
3. 政策环境
市场的波动也受到政策调控的影响,如利率变动、货币政策调整等都会对价格产生连锁反应。
二、交易策略的优化
1. 趋势跟随策略
当市场形成明显的上升或下降趋势时,交易者可以利用技术分析工具(如均线、突破信号)进行顺势交易,从而提高胜率。
2. 震荡市场策略
当市场处于震荡区间时,均值回归策略可能更适用。通过技术指标识别支撑位与压力位,在低位买入,高位卖出,提高资金利用率。
3. 资金管理策略
无论采用何种交易策略,合理的资金管理至关重要。控制每笔交易的风险比重,设置止损点,并分散投资,有助于降低极端市场情况下的损失。
三、Python 代码示例:计算价格波动率
以下 Python 代码使用 NumPy 计算市场价格的历史波动率,为交易者提供参考。
import numpy as np
# 模拟市场价格数据
prices = np.array([100, 102, 101, 103, 105, 104, 106, 108, 107, 110])
# 计算对数收益率
log_returns = np.log(prices[1:] / prices[:-1])
# 计算年化波动率(假设252个交易日)
volatility = np.std(log_returns) * np.sqrt(252)
print(f"市场年化波动率: {volatility:.2%}")
四、总结
市场波动是交易中的常态,交易者需要结合市场环境,制定合适的交易策略,同时通过风险管理工具降低交易中的不确定性。通过趋势分析、资金管理和技术工具的结合,交易者可以更有效地捕捉市场机会,实现稳健交易。